软件开发的心得体会PPT.pptxVIP

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

软件开发的心得体会

目录CONTENTS引言软件开发流程体验技术选型与工具应用心得团队协作与沟通技巧项目管理与时间规划经验持续改进与自我提升计划

01引言

分享在软件开发过程中的学习体验、所遇挑战及应对策略。随着信息技术的飞速发展,软件开发已成为当今社会的核心产业之一。越来越多的人选择投身这一领域,追求技术创新与职业发展。目的和背景背景目的

涵盖开发语言、工具、框架的选择与应用,以及代码编写、测试、优化等方面的经验。技术层面团队协作个人成长涉及项目管理、沟通协作、任务分配等团队工作方面的感悟。分享在软件开发过程中,如何不断提升自己的技能、解决问题的能力以及应对压力的心态调整。030201汇报范围

02软件开发流程体验求分析阶段与客户充分沟通,理解项目需求和目标。进行需求调研,收集相关资料和信息。编写需求文档,明确功能需求、性能需求等。与团队成员讨论,确保对需求理解一致。

设计阶段根据需求文档,进行软件架构设计。编写设计文档,包括系统流程图、数据库设计等。选择合适的技术栈和开发工具。与团队成员评审设计方案,确保技术可行性。

按照设计文档进行编码实现。定期进行代码审查,及时发现和修正问题。遵循编码规范,保证代码质量和可读性。与团队成员协作,共同解决技术难题。编码实现阶段

测试与调试阶段进行单元测试、集成测试和系统测试。与测试团队紧密合作,确保软件质量。编写测试用例,覆盖所有功能和边界情况。使用调试工具定位并解决问题。

收集用户反馈,进行问题排查和修复。对软件进行定期维护和更新。对软件性能进行优化,提高运行效率。不断学习和掌握新技术,为软件升级做好准备护与优化阶段

03技术选型与工具应用心得

ABCD前端技术选型及实践响应式设计与框架选择适合项目需求的响应式设计框架,如Bootstrap、Vue等,实现页面自适应不同设备。交互体验优化关注页面加载速度、动画效果、表单验证等细节,提升用户体验。模块化与组件化采用模块化、组件化的开发方式,提高代码复用率和可维护性。跨浏览器兼容性针对不同浏览器进行兼容性测试,确保页面在不同环境下表现一致。

语言与框架选择高可用与扩展性安全性考虑性能优化后端技术选型及实践根据项目需求选择合适的编程语言和框架,如JavaSpringBoot、PythonDjango等。加强身份验证、权限控制、数据加密等方面的安全防护措施。设计具备高可用性和扩展性的系统架构,应对流量波动和业务增长。关注数据库查询优化、缓存策略、异步处理等技术手段,提升系统性能。

关系型数据库非关系型数据库数据库设计与优化数据备份与恢复数据库技术选型及实践针对特定场景选择合适的非关系型数据库,如MongoDB、Redis等,以支持更灵活的数据存储需求。合理设计数据库表结构和索引,定期进行数据库性能优化和维护。建立完善的数据备份和恢复机制,确保数据安全可靠。选用成熟稳定的关系型数据库如MySQL、PostgreSQL等,满足大部分业务需求。

熟练掌握Git等版本控制工具的使用,实现代码的版本管理和协作开发。Git等版本控制工具通过持续集成和持续部署工具自动化构建、测试和发布流程,减少人工干预和错误。持续集成与持续部署制定合理的分支策略和代码审查机制,提高代码质量和开发效率。分支策略与代码审查利用版本控制工具的问题跟踪功能进行项目管理和任务分配,保持团队协同高效。问题跟踪与项目管本控制工具使用经验

04团队协作与沟通技巧

确保每个团队成员都清楚项目目标和自己的职责,避免工作重复或遗漏。明确目标与分工团队成员间应相互信任、尊重彼此的专业能力和贡献,形成良好的团队氛围。建立信任与尊重定期召开团队会议,分享工作进展、交流问题和解决方案,保持信息畅通。定期沟通与同步鼓励团队成员提出创新想法和改进建议,不断优化工作流程和提升团队效率。鼓励创新与改进高效团队协作方法分享

倾听与理解认真倾听他人的意见和建议,理解对方的立场和需求,避免误解和冲突。多种沟通方式根据实际情况选择面对面交流、电话、电子邮件等多种沟通方式,确保信息准确传达。及时反馈对于他人的问题和需求,要及时给予反馈和回应,保持沟通的连续性和有效性。清晰表达沟通时要用简洁明了的语言表达自己的观点和需求,避免模糊不清或产生歧义。有效沟通技巧总结

分析问题原因遇到问题时要冷静分析问题的原因和本质,找到解决问题的关键点。积极寻求解决方案鼓励团队成员积极提出解决方案,集思广益,共同解决问题。保持客观公正在处理冲突时要保持客观公正的态度,不偏袒任何一方,以事实为依据进行调解。及时反馈与跟进对于问题的解决情况和进展要及时向相关人员反馈,确保问题得到妥善解决。解决冲突和问题的方法

05项目管理与时间规划经验

项目进度管理策略制定详细的项目计划在

文档评论(0)

191****1523 + 关注
官方认证
文档贡献者

该用户很懒,什么也没介绍

认证主体 温江区新意智创互联网信息服务工作室(个体工商户)
IP属地四川
统一社会信用代码/组织机构代码
92510115MADQ1P5F2L

1亿VIP精品文档

相关文档